The controler take's a few steps but it's rather easy. I'll post them here right now since the template isn't up. It looks like alot of steps but they are very simple.
Step1 - Find an image you like, and copy it.
Step2 - post it in the folder named "controller image" Note: it will cover the xbox360 but that won't matter.
Step3 - While on the layer that is the image you want on the controller move the opacity down until you can see the controller behind it
Step4 - Arrange/resize the image until you get all of what you want showing on the controller ontop of it. you can now turn the opacity to 100% again.
Step5 - Ctrl+click on the layer named "Ctrl+click" make sure you are still on the layer of the image that you want to be on the controller though
Step6 - hit Ctrl+C
Step7 - Delete the layer that contains image you want to be on your controler
Step8 - Go to the folder that say's "controller image" and hit Ctrl+V
Step9 - Turn down the opacity of the image until you can see the curves of the mounds around the analog sticks and you think it looks good.
Step10 - YOU'RE DONE! all you have to do is copy and paste
in image in the folder "Faceplate image" to cover the faceplate and move it around as you please.
